Renderings Revealed for Earlington Metro's 856-unit Development at Earlington Heights Metrorail Station

A significant residential complex is being planned at the Earlington Heights Metrorail station by developer Earlington Metro, LLC. Last week, new renderings and detailed plans were submitted for review.

Project Overview

The developer has filed for Miami-Dade Administrative Site Plan Review to advance the workforce multifamily development project. The proposal includes the construction of two 15-story towers on the site currently occupied by bus bays.

Project Details

The development is set to feature 856 residential units and 33,827 square feet of retail space. The land, which will be leased from the county, aims to integrate residential and retail components to serve the local community.

Architectural Design

The renowned firm Arquitectonica is responsible for the architectural design of the project. The new plans and renderings were officially submitted to Miami-Dade County on June 19.
